Colt Terry, Green Beret follows one of the earliest U.S. Army Special Forces warriors through the birth of America’s first Green Beret units—where mastery of weapons, languages, and unconventional warfare was forged under relentless training.

A veteran of the 82nd Airborne and Korea, Terry extended his service into Vietnam and Cambodia, working alongside the Montagnards and Khmer. From Pleiku, Duc Co, and Plei Me to elephant-back supply runs through jungle trails, his story captures the ingenuity, courage, and command required of Special Forces—an inside view of missions that defined the Green Beret legacy.
